Job Title: AI Engineer (Generative AI & Machine Learning Specialist)
Location: Manchester or London
Employment Type: Full-time
Experience Level: Mid to Senior
About the Role
As an AI Engineer, you will design, build, and deploy AI and machine learning solutions using generative models and advanced ML models and techniques. You will leverage Databricks to create scalable and efficient workflows while collaborating with clients and internal teams to deliver high-value solutions. This role combines technical expertise with creativity to develop next-generation AI applications for diverse industries.
Key Responsibilities
- Generative AI Development: Design and fine-tune generative models (e.g., Llama 2, MPT, GPT, DALL-E, Stable Diffusion) for applications such as natural language processing, content creation, or synthetic data generation.
- Machine Learning: Build and deploy advanced machine learning models for tasks like classification, regression, recommendation systems, and anomaly detection.
- Platform Integration: Develop scalable ML pipelines on Databricks, utilizing tools like MLflow, Delta Lake, and Spark for end-to-end workflows.
- Solution Architecture: Collaborate with architects and engineers to design AI systems that address specific business needs and integrate seamlessly with existing infrastructures.
- Model Optimization: Optimize AI and ML models for performance, scalability, and cost efficiency, including distributed training on Databricks.
- Cloud Deployment: Leverage cloud services (Azure, AWS, GCP) to deploy, monitor, and manage AI and ML models in production.
- Innovation & Prototyping: Develop prototypes and proof-of-concept solutions using generative AI and ML to demonstrate value to clients.
Required:
- 4+ years of experience in AI and machine learning development.
- Hands-on experience with Databricks and cloud-based AI/ML solutions (ML Flow, Mosaic AI).
- Proficiency in Python and machine learning frameworks like TensorFlow, PyTorch, or Scikit-learn.
- Experience with generative models (e.g., LLM’s, Multi-Modal Models, VAEs, GANs) and their deployment.
- Strong knowledge of Databricks tools such as MLflow, Mosaic AI, Delta Lake, and Apache Spark.
- Deep understanding of machine learning algorithms, model training, and evaluation techniques.
- Experience with Azure (preferred), AWS, or GCP for model deployment and infrastructure management.
- Strong analytical and problem-solving skills.
- Excellent communication abilities for both technical and non-technical audiences.
- Experience with CI/CD for machine learning workflows and automated model deployment.
- Certifications in Databricks or cloud platforms (e.g., Azure AI Engineer Associate).
- Knowledge of real-time data processing and streaming applications.
- Familiarity with visualization tools like Power BI or Tableau.
- Experience applying AI solutions in industries such as healthcare, finance, or retail.
Why Join Us?
- Impactful Projects: Work on innovative AI and ML solutions that drive measurable business outcomes for global clients.
- Growth Opportunities: Advance your expertise in generative AI, machine learning, and Databricks technologies.
- Innovative Team: Join a collaborative team of AI experts who are passionate about solving complex challenges.
- Competitive Benefits: Enjoy a competitive salary, comprehensive benefits, and flexible working arrangements.
Key Skills
Ranked by relevance
Related Jobs
3 roles aligned with this opportunity
Lead Data Scientist with Python
2026-05-29
Java/Spring Backend Software Engineer Professional
2026-05-22
Senior Developer
2026-02-12
- Posted
- Dec 05, 2024
- Type
- Full-time
- Level
- Mid-Senior
- Location
- England
- Company
- NP Group
Industries
Categories
Related Jobs
3 roles aligned with this opportunity
Lead Data Scientist with Python
2026-05-29
Java/Spring Backend Software Engineer Professional
2026-05-22
Senior Developer
2026-02-12